在当今数字化时代,图片分类展示网站已经成为人们获取视觉信息和设计灵感的首选平台,这些网站不仅提供了海量的图片资源,还通过智能的分类和搜索功能,使得用户能够轻松找到所需的设计素材,本文将深入探讨图片分类展示网站的源码设计,以及它们如何为设计师、摄影师和其他创意人士带来无限的可能。
网站架构与开发环境
前端技术栈
前端页面采用HTML5、CSS3和JavaScript等技术构建,确保页面响应式设计和跨设备兼容性,利用Vue.js或React等现代框架进行组件化开发,提高代码的可维护性和可扩展性。
后端技术栈
后端服务器使用Node.js配合Express框架搭建RESTful API接口,处理图片的上传、存储和管理等功能,数据库方面,选择MySQL或MongoDB来存储图片信息及相关元数据。
图片分类与管理
分类系统设计
图片分类是网站的核心功能之一,我们采用了树形结构来组织不同的类别,如“人物”、“风景”、“动物”等一级分类,再细分为更具体的二级分类,肖像”、“山水”、“花卉”等,这种多层次的结构便于用户快速定位到感兴趣的图片类别。
图片来源于网络,如有侵权联系删除
图片管理界面
管理员可以通过Web图形用户界面(GUI)对图片进行添加、编辑和删除操作,管理员可以创建新的分类标签,调整现有类别的层级关系,甚至批量导入大量图片并进行自动分类。
搜索与推荐算法
关键词搜索
用户可以通过输入关键词进行精确搜索,系统会返回包含该关键词的所有图片结果,为了提升用户体验,我们还实现了模糊匹配和多语言支持的功能。
推荐算法
除了关键词搜索外,我们还引入了机器学习算法来个性化推荐相关图片给用户,通过对用户的浏览历史和行为分析,系统能够预测出用户可能感兴趣的其他图片类型和建议。
图片展示与交互
图片预览与放大
当用户点击某个分类下的缩略图时,页面会显示一张大尺寸的预览图供用户进一步查看细节,还可以实现图片的平滑滚动效果,让用户在使用过程中感到流畅自然。
用户反馈机制
为了让网站更加贴近市场需求,我们在每个图片页面上都设置了投票按钮,允许用户点赞或踩,这样不仅可以增加用户的互动参与度,还能帮助我们了解哪些类型的图片最受欢迎,从而优化后续内容的更新方向。
图片来源于网络,如有侵权联系删除
安全性考虑
数据加密传输
所有用户数据和文件上传过程都使用了HTTPS协议进行保护,防止中间人攻击和数据泄露的风险。
文件安全检查
在上传新图片之前,会对文件格式进行检查以确保只有合法格式的图片才能被成功保存至服务器上,同时也会扫描恶意软件和病毒的存在,保障系统的稳定运行和安全。
未来发展方向
随着技术的不断进步和创新,我们可以预见未来的图片分类展示网站将会朝着以下几个方向发展:
- AI辅助创作:借助深度学习和计算机视觉技术,帮助创作者生成高质量的合成图像或者自动完成某些复杂的后期处理工作;
- 虚拟现实体验:结合VR/AR技术,打造沉浸式的视觉盛宴,让人们在虚拟世界中感受到真实世界的美好景象;
- 社交分享功能:加强社区建设,鼓励用户之间进行交流和合作,共同推动整个行业的繁荣发展;
图片分类展示网站作为连接设计师与灵感之间的桥梁,其重要性不言而喻,在未来日子里,我们将继续努力改进和完善我们的产品和服务,为广大用户提供更加优质便捷的使用体验。
标签: #图片分类展示网站源码
评论列表